GENE - CHEMICAL INTERACTIONS REPORT

RGD ID: 3171
Species: Rattus norvegicus
RGD Object: Gene
Symbol: Nfkbia
Name: NFKB inhibitor alpha
Acc ID: CHEBI:18388
Term: apigenin
Definition: A trihydroxyflavone that is flavone substituted by hydroxy groups at positions 4', 5 and 7. It induces autophagy in leukaemia cells.
Chemical ID: MESH:D047310
Note: Use of the qualifier "multiple interactions" designates that the annotated interaction is comprised of a complex set of reactions and/or regulatory events, possibly involving additional chemicals and/or gene products.
